Classwork Prelab
Converging Lens Students began the process of
determining the focal length of the lens and setting up the lens
optical bench marking 1F and 2F on both sides of the lens. The
objective is to determine the relationship between object distance
and image distance and to examine the properties of the image
as real virtual magnified, reduced, erect and inverted. Look for
patterns in the data. The lab will be completed tomorrow.

Handout Planet Cards and Instruction sheet
Collected nothing
Classwork Explained the internet project to
create a set of planet cards.
complete
both sides of the cards - the back of the card will hav3e
the
factual information entered on it. The front of the card will
include
the accurately drawn in axis of rotation, the equator at 90
degrees
to the axis of rotation, the number of moons along the
equator,
the number of rings if it has rings, the cloud bands,
unique
features identifyiable to the specific planet. These cards may
be
used on the final. Finish outside of class, this is the only day
in
the computer lab to complete these cards.
